#661cb2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#661cb2 is composed of 40% red, 11% green and 69.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 42.7% cyan, 84.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 30.2% black. It has a hue angle of 269.6 degrees, a saturation of 72.8% and a lightness of 40.4%. #661cb2 color hex could be obtained by blending #cc38ff with #000065. Closest websafe color is: #663399.

#661cb2 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#661cb2 has RGB values of R:102, G:28, B:178 and CMYK values of C:0.43, M:0.84, Y:0, K:0.3. Its decimal value is 6692018.

Shades and Tints of #661cb2
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050109 is the darkest color, while #faf7fe is the lightest one.
